Fehler: [$Injektor:nomod] Modul 'ui.bootstrap' ist nicht verfügbar! während Karma run in webstorm
Hallo, ich bin immer die folgende Fehlermeldung in webstorm während der Ausführung von karma-test laufen
Error: [$injector:nomod] Module 'ui.bootstrap', 'ui.unique' is not available!
You either misspelled the module name or forgot to load it.
If registering a module ensure that you specify the dependencies as the second argument.
schaute ich im internet, und Sie sagten, um zu überprüfen, Abhängigkeit-Datei ui.bootstrap könnte vermisst werden, wie die.
aber die Anwendung funktioniert gut
und beim testen nur es zeigt diesen Fehler
in meinem karma.conf.js
files: [
//angular files
'app/js/vendor/angular/ui.bootstrap.js',
'app/js/vendor/angular/ui.bootstrap-0.10.0.js',
'app/js/vendor/angular/angular.js',
'app/js/vendor/angular/angular-mocks-0.10.6.js',
'app/js/app.js',
'test/**/*Spec.js'
],
in meinem Modul declartion
var myApp = angular.module('myApp', ['ui.bootstrap']);
Könnten Sie bitte helfen????
Du musst angemeldet sein, um einen Kommentar abzugeben.
ui.unique
ist ein Modul ausangular-ui-utils
. Das muss einbezogen werden in das karma conf und injiziert, um die app als gut, wenn Sie verwendet wird.oder Sie können gezielt injizieren
ui.unique
statt Injektionui.utils
, wenn auch nur einmalig-Modul verwendet wird.